Address 0 FTC

6k5aBfEDnZia1FzFDbq4S1dHhHdA3bpHyZ

Confirmed

Total Received9.37777607 FTC
Total Sent9.37777607 FTC
Final Balance0 FTC
No. Transactions2

Transactions